A fine looking, and certainly playable, persimmon driver from a small Edinburgh firm.
Stamped on the crown "W Cunningham Edinburgh" in an oval, the original gold paint is still visible. Below this oval is stamped "Special".
The sole is in perfect condition, the black fibre slip secured in the traditional way by three hickory dowels.
The straight hickory shaft is stamped "T Auchterlonie St Andrews". Perhaps he made the club, it dates from around the time he set up in business on his own account or perhaps it is a later replacement. The club is finished with a black rubberised replacement grip.
